Summary: "Bringing together the techniques required to analyse questionnaires, this book is the ideal companion for non-mathematical students with no prior knowledge of quantitative methods. Using rich examples from a range of settings, this book analyses basic principles, provides hands on data analysis with data sets and both SPSS and Stata packages and explores how to articulate the calculations and theory around the statistical techniques. This is the ideal introductory textbook for any student looking to begin and expand their knowledge on how to analyse questionnaires and help improve statistical knowledge and learning as well as interpretation"--
